Arkansas Code § 14-53-106 - Holiday Compensation

(a) All firefighters employed by cities of the first or second class or incorporated towns shall be compensated for all legal holidays established by the governing body of the municipality.

(b) This compensation shall be based on the firefighter's daily rate of pay and in addition to the regular pay schedule.

(c) This compensation may be included within the firefighter's base pay.

(d) This compensation shall be prorated and paid during the regular payroll periods or paid in one (1) lump sum annually on a date in December designated by the municipality.
